Liberty Reserve Casinos: Frequently Asked Questions

What is Liberty Reserve?

Liberty Reserve was an e-wallet payment method that ceased operations in 2013. It allowed users to transfer funds securely online and was a popular choice for online casino transactions.

Can I still use Liberty Reserve to deposit at online casinos?

No, Liberty Reserve is no longer in operation and cannot be used as a deposit method at online casinos.

Why did Liberty Reserve shut down?

Liberty Reserve was shut down by authorities in 2013 due to its association with money laundering and other illegal activities.

Can I get my money back from my Liberty Reserve account?

Unfortunately, after the shutdown of Liberty Reserve, users were unable to access their accounts or retrieve their stored funds.
